Grantville would have been located within present day Greene County<2>.


The location of Grantville has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<3>


While the community is gone, the present day location for Grantville is 630 feet [192 m] above sea level.<4>.

Time Zone: The area where Grantville was located is in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Grantville would have been located in the (706) and (762)<5> area codes.

Communities Also Named Grantville ...

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two Georgia communities named Grantville: This one is located in Greene County and the other is located in Coweta County.

Beyond Georgia, there are 11 communities that are also named Grantville - they are located in Alabama, California, Connecticut, Kansas, Massachusetts, New York, North Carolina, Nova Scotia, Pennsylvania and Tennessee.
